The HelpProvider is an IExtender interfaces that "adds" a property to your controls. This value is actually persisted along with the Control (if you write your own IExtender component, you're responsible for persisting this map). Work with the HelpProvider and you shouldn't have any problems.

If that doesn't work, the designer always writes a values to the Control.Name property, which you could use as a keyword. If you support nesting of container controls that contain the same names, do something similar to ASP.NET and built a delimited name that resolve the child, like "Parent1_Parent2_Control1" (this is what the INamingContainer marker interface for ASP.NET is for).
